Light Quark Masses with Dynamical Wilson Fermions
N.Eicker ; U.Glässner ; S.Güsken ; H.Hoeber ; P.Lacock ; Th.Lippert ; G.Ritzenhöfer ; K.Schilling ; G.Siegert ; A.Spitz ; P.Ueberholz ; J.Viehoff ;
Date 29 Apr 1997
Journal Phys.Lett. B407 (1997) 290-296
Subject hep-lat hep-ph
AffiliationSESAM-Collaboration; HLRZ/DESY and Wuppertal University
AbstractWe determine the masses of the light and the strange quarks in the $ar{MS}$-scheme using our high-statistics lattice simulation of QCD with dynamical Wilson fermions. For the light quark mass we find $m^{light}_{ar{MS}}(2 GeV) = 2.7(2) MeV$, which is lower than in quenched simulations. For the strange quark, in a sea of two dynamical light quarks, we obtain $m^{strange}_{ar{MS}}(2 GeV) = 140(20) MeV$.
